Oxidized Ethylene/Propylene Copolymer

INCI: OXIDIZED ETHYLENE/PROPYLENE COPOLYMER

A synthetic polymer that helps products stay put and resist water, generally considered safe and non-irritating.

beautyskincarefilm-former

In plain English

This is a man-made ingredient that forms a thin, flexible film on your skin or hair. Think of it like a clear, breathable plastic wrap that helps makeup last longer, prevents sunscreen from washing off, and gives creams a smooth, silky feel. It doesn't actively treat your skin, but it improves how a product performs.

What it is

A synthetic copolymer made from ethylene and propylene gases that have been oxidized to create a waxy, film-forming substance. It is commonly used in cosmetics to improve water resistance and texture.

How it works

When applied, the copolymer molecules link together to form a continuous, flexible film on the skin or hair surface. This film acts as a barrier that slows water loss and helps other ingredients (like pigments or UV filters) stay in place longer.

Pros

Boosts wear time

Helps makeup and sunscreen stay put for hours, even in humid conditions or water exposure.

Non-irritating

Rated very low on irritation and comedogenic scales, making it suitable for sensitive skin types.

Cons and cautions

Can feel heavy

On oily or combination skin, the film may feel sticky or greasy, especially in hot weather.

Requires double cleansing

Because it forms a water-resistant film, a simple water rinse won't remove it; you'll need an oil-based cleanser or micellar water.

Safety summary

Oxidized Ethylene/Propylene Copolymer is considered safe for topical use. It has low irritation and comedogenic potential, and no significant safety concerns have been raised by regulatory bodies.

Research notes

Research on this specific copolymer is limited, but it is chemically similar to other well-studied film-forming polymers used in cosmetics. Safety assessments by industry panels have found it safe at typical use levels.

Common label clues

Typical concentration
1% to 10%
Regulatory status
Approved for use in cosmetics globally, including by the U.S. FDA and EU CosIng database, with no known restrictions at typical concentrations.
Common uses
Lipsticks, Mascaras, Sunscreens, Water-resistant creams
Environmental note
As a synthetic polymer, it is not biodegradable and may contribute to microplastic pollution. Some brands are moving toward biodegradable alternatives.

Good to know

  • This ingredient is often found in 'transfer-proof' or '24-hour wear' makeup formulas.
  • It is not absorbed into the skin; it sits on the surface and is washed off.
